The Spain Business Intelligence Market was estimated at USD 164 Million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 193 Million by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 2.6% from 2026 to 2032.
The strongest force currently shaping the Spain Business Intelligence Market is the widespread shift towards data-driven decision-making. Companies across various sectors are increasingly recognizing the value of harnessing data analytics to optimize operations and enhance strategic planning.
As organizations demand more agility and speed in their analytics capabilities, the adoption of cloud-based solutions has surged. This trend not only provides scalability but also empowers users with self-service tools that facilitate independent insight generation without heavy reliance on IT departments.

Despite the positive growth trajectory, the Spain Business Intelligence Market faces notable restraints. Data privacy regulations, particularly the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), impose stringent requirements on how organizations handle personal data. Compliance with these regulations complicates the deployment of BI tools and necessitates robust data governance frameworks.
on top of that, the increasing diversity of data sources complicates integration and analysis, straining traditional BI systems. The talent gap in data analytics and BI expertise also presents a challenge, hindering organizations from fully realizing the potential of their BI investments.
Several key trends are shaping the Spain Business Intelligence Market. The shift towards cloud-based BI solutions is accelerating, as organizations seek the flexibility and cost-effectiveness these platforms provide. Self-service BI is gaining traction, enabling end-users to access and analyze data without needing extensive IT support, thereby streamlining decision-making processes.
In addition, advanced analytics tools, including predictive analytics and AI-driven solutions, are becoming increasingly vital for businesses aiming to stay competitive. The integration of BI with emerging technologies like IoT and big data is also gaining momentum, allowing for deeper insights and improved operational efficiency.

Government policy in Spain plays a crucial role in shaping the Business Intelligence Market, particularly concerning data protection and technological advancement. The government emphasizes compliance with GDPR while promoting BI technology adoption, particularly in the public sector, to enhance decision-making and efficiency.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.
By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
